1994 Plymouth Laser FWD L4-1997cc 2.0L DOHC
Engine Coolant Temperature Sensor Description
1994 Plymouth Laser FWD L4-1997cc 2.0L DOHCSECTION Engine Coolant Temperature Sensor Description
Location
The coolant temperature sensor is located in the thermostat housing.

Construction
The Coolant Temperature Sensor is a thermistor type sensor.

Operation
As engine temperature increases, sensor resistance decreases. The ECM monitors engine temperature by the sensor output voltage and provides optimum fuel enrichment when the engine is cold.
